President Biden developed a strong working relationship with Mitch McConnell over the years. The same isn't true for him and new Republican Speaker Kevin McCarthy.

Ahead of their first Oval Office sit-down last week, McCarthy responded to a similar question with a lengthy verbal shrug.

When McCarthy was fighting for his job last month in round after round of speaker votes, Biden and McConnell were holding a political event together marking the bipartisan infrastructure law."I asked permission if I could say something nice about him," Biden joked as he praised McConnell from the stage."I said I'd campaign for or against him, whichever helped most. "We understand what the Speaker is going through," White House Press Secretary Karine Jean-Pierre told reporters Wednesday."He has a caucus that has put forth some pretty extreme ideas. Some extreme options in front of the American people. Cutting Medicare, cutting Social Security. That is what he's dealing with."
